Alan Cumming is back in blue, and this time, it’s hitting different. The beloved actor, known for his iconic portrayal of the teleporting mutant Nightcrawler in 2003’s X2, has recently wrapped up filming for the highly anticipated Marvel film Avengers: Doomsday. In an exclusive with People, Cumming shared how stepping back into the character’s shoes after all these years felt like a breath of fresh, yet familiar air, especially given the rough ride he had during the original production on X2. With the movie slated to hit theaters on December 18, 2026, fans are hyped about this reunion along with many other old X-Men returning for this Avengers film.
The Return
He describes his experience as “insane” to come back to the superhero fold with this character.
- A Nice Return:“I just came back. It was amazing. It was actually really… in a sort of ooey, gooey way, it was really healing and really nice to go back to something that it was a terrible experience when I did it the first time…” Alan Cumming
- Getting Shots Filmed Fast: Alan revealed that he had to do scenes rather quickly and that he had to ractice with the stuntman at 60 years of age.
